Alexey Balabanov. Find Your Own and Calm Down (2020)

Genre : Documentary

Runtime : 1H 47M

Director : Lyudmila Snigireva
Writer : Elena Nikolaeva

Synopsis

His motto was laconic: "I promised - stay still." This is how Alexei Balabanov lived, raised his sons, was friends, and so filmed. A legendary director and an extraordinary person who made both "festival" and "mass" films with equal ease. He was a great father and a difficult husband, a loyal friend and an honest guy. Balabanov with his life, passions, losses, burning pain on the way to God in the memories of those closest to him - mother, sons, wife and friends. He seems to be telling the crew again: "Let's do it talentedly!"
